Sub-Coulomb resonances in the /sup 12/C-/sup 12/C system through the reaction /sup 12/C(/sup 12/C, /sup 16/O)/sup 8/Be

Journal Article · · Phys. Rev. Lett.; (United States)
The excitation functions of the reaction /sup 12/C(/sup 12/C,/sup 16/O(g.s.))/sup 8/Be(g.s.) were measured at 35degree lab (approx.90degree c.m.) and at 20degree lab (approx.50degree c.m.) near and above the Coulomb barrier (5.75 < or = E/sub c. m./ < or = 8.9 MeV). Resonant structures were found at 5.94, 6.35, 6.69, 8.0, and 8.4 MeV. These resonant structures were correlated with those in the elastic channel. The angular distributions at 6.4, 6.65, and 8.0 MeV were measured, and spin-parity assignments are 2/sup +/, 2/sup +/, and 4/sup +/, respectively. The oxygen partial width at 5.94 MeV was determined to be 14 keV, which is a large as the carbon partial width.
